Millions aspire to crack UPSC Civil Services Examination. Yet, each year fewer than 1000 candidates make it to the final rank list of UPSC CSE. In this regard, choosing the right optional subject is a major ingredient in determining a candidate’s position in the final rank list.

Your optional subject contributes 500 marks out of the total 1750 marks in the UPSC Mains examination. This makes the optional subject the single most important subject for UPSC Civil Services Examination.

Among all optional subjects, literature subjects are generally high scoring. Malayalam Literature Optional is no different. Malayalam Optional is usually selected by Keralites and the residents of the Union Territory of Lakshadweep.

Merits of Malayalam Literature Optional for UPSC Civil Services Examination:
  • Comparatively smaller syllabus.
  • Static nature of Syllabus and Questions.
  • Repeated questions from the same areas as in previous years.
  • Expressing in Mother-tongue is easier.
  • Learning Malayalam literature, especially Paper-2 portions, will rejuvenate one’s mind.

  • Less competition – A candidate will be competing only within a small pool, with Keralites who have cleared prelims.
De-merits of Malayalam Literature Optional for UPSC Civil Services Examination:
  • Hardly any overlap with other GS papers
  • Literature is not everyone’s cup of tea; passion for the subject is crucial.
